So I've been looking into e6 lately and feel I have a pretty great understanding of it, but from time to time when I see people talking about feats post level 6 they may say something like epic feats.

Does this in fact mean that a character who has reached level 6 can begin to take feats normally reserved for epic level 21+ characters? if the level 6 character happens to qualify? For example if a level 6 character somehow managed to reach 25 con could he then take the fast healing feat to give himself fast healing 3?

I was under the impression that this was NOT the case, but I want to make sure and clarify because this would be a VERY big deal if it was actually the case.

I've never seen anyone using that interpretation of "epic feat" in E6 before. I've always understood it and used it to refer to the feats you gain every 5,000xp. This is mostly done because there are some homebrewed feats or other abilities that require you to have a certain number of feats beyond level 6 to qualify. "Epic" is just used to more succinctly describe feats gained past level 6.

I sometimes pick out the 20+ level epic feats and let people use them, because a lot of them are basically worthless. But I think people are referring to epic as-in post level 6 feat gaining, not an actual set of epic feats.

The great stat epic feats for instance are each 1/2 of a weapon focus, so they are generally useless. If you make ruinous rage only require improved sunder and power attack, it is like a worse version of a level 1 maneuver.
